Bulgur is parboiled, dried, and cracked whole durum wheat. Per 100g raw, it delivers 342 kcal, 75.9g carbohydrates (18.3g fiber), 12.3g protein, and 1.33g fat with a low glycemic index of 46.

Pearl barley (Hordeum vulgare) is polished barley with outer bran removed. Per 100g raw, it provides 352 kcal, 77.7g carbohydrates (15.6g fiber), 9.91g protein, and 1.16g fat with an ultra-low glycemic index of 28.
